Awarded Projects for July 2021

Congratulations to Christy Gabbard for her award from the Florida Department of Education; Herman Knopf for his award from the Charles & Margery Barancik Foundation; Philip Poekert for his subcontract awards DHHS Flow Through from Florida’s Office of Early Learning; Paige Pullen for her award from Trident United Way; and Wanli Xing for his award from Schwab Charitable.
